The Polaris RMK Dragon 800 engine coolant bottle jug and reservoir cap (Part Numbers: 2520843 and 2520810) are essential components designed specifically for the Polaris RMK Dragon 800 snowmobile model. This cooling system equipment is crucial for ensuring optimal engine performance and longevity during various driving conditions.
The coolant bottle jug is a replacement component for the original one, designed to house the engine coolant, a critical liquid responsible for absorbing the heat produced by the engine during operation. This bottle jug is engineered with high-quality materials, including durable plastics, to provide resistance against extreme temperatures, weather conditions, and wear-and-tear. Its shape and design allow for easy access for topping off the coolant level when needed.
The reservoir cap is another integral component in this cooling system setup. It fits tightly on the coolant bottle jug, shielding the coolant from environmental contaminants while allowing the exchange of pressurized air and coolant inside the engine. This cap is designed with an integral pressure relief vent that assists in maintaining the correct coolant level and prevents potential engine damage due to excessive pressure build-up.
